Join our team as a Talent Acquisition Specialist!
Are you an experienced recruiter passionate about connecting talented professionals with meaningful healthcare careers? We are seeking a proactive and relationship-driven Talent Acquisition Specialist to join our Human Resources team. In this role, you will lead full-cycle recruitment efforts, build strong candidate pipelines, and help attract exceptional talent to support our growing healthcare organization.
Key Responsibilities
- Manage the full-cycle recruitment process from sourcing through offer acceptance.
- Screen, evaluate, and refer qualified candidates to hiring managers for interviews.
- Extend employment offers in alignment with compensation guidelines and organizational policies.
- Ensure all pre-employment screening requirements are completed accurately and on time.
- Partner with hiring managers to identify and address hard-to-fill positions.
- Recommend recruitment solutions, including compensation reviews, sign-on incentives, and targeted advertising strategies.
- Represent the organization at job fairs, career events, networking opportunities, and recruitment functions.
- Build and maintain relationships with colleges, universities, and healthcare training programs.
- Educate candidates and new hires on employee benefits and onboarding processes.
- Track recruitment metrics and provide regular reports on hiring activity.
- Support organizational initiatives that promote service excellence, employee engagement, and a culture of safety
Qualifications
Required
- Minimum of 4 years of recruiting or human resources experience.
- High School Diploma or equivalent
- Experience managing multiple job requisitions and recruiting priorities.
- Strong relationship-building, interviewing, and talent assessment skills.
- Excellent verbal and written communication abilities.
- Valid Driver's License with no driving restrictions.
- Ability to travel to recruiting events, colleges, and community outreach opportunities as needed.
Preferred
- Bachelor's degree in human resources, Business Administration, Healthcare Administration, or a related field.
- 2+ years of previous healthcare recruitment experience strongly preferred
- Experience recruiting for clinical, non-clinical, or healthcare support positions.
Technical Skills
- Proficiency with Microsoft Office products
- Experience using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S) and recruitment technologies strongly preferred.
- Ability to analyze hiring data and recruitment trends.
